Step 1: Power off the OPPO F5 by holding the power button and selecting "Shut Down".

Step 2: Boot into Recovery Mode by pressing and holding the Power Button and the Volume Down Button simultaneously. Release them once the OPPO logo flashes on the screen. How to Hard Reset OPPO F5

Step 3: In the Recovery Mode menu, navigate using the Volume buttons to select your preferred language and press the Power button to confirm.

Step 4: Select "Wipe data and cache".

Step 5: Select "Erase everything (Music, pics, etc)". Note: This is the factory reset option. Tone: Detailed and SEO-friendly

Step 6: Confirm by selecting "Yes". The phone will begin formatting the data.

Step 7: Once the process is complete, select "Reboot" to restart the system.
